Comparison of Machine Types and Applications

Machine Type Description Applications
CNC Machines Computer-controlled machining tools for precision work. Aerospace, automotive components.
Lathes Machines that rotate a workpiece to perform various operations. Custom parts, prototypes.
Milling Machines Tools that remove material from a workpiece using rotary cutters. Fabrication, part production.
Welding Equipment Tools used for joining materials through melting and fusion. Structural applications.
Tooling & Fixtures Custom-made devices to hold and support workpieces during machining. High precision tasks.

Lathes

Lathes are essential for turning operations where a workpiece rotates against a cutting tool. At Superior Machine & Tool, they operate eight lathes, three of which are CNC-enabled. This allows the company to produce a wide range of components, from single prototypes to large batches, with tight tolerances and polished finishes.

Milling Machines

Milling is a critical process for shaping materials. Superior Machine & Tool features a range of milling machines, including knee mills and CNC vertical mills, equipped with advanced controls. These machines excel in creating complex geometries and are ideal for both metals and plastics.
